Background
This is Mark Farrell's vanity plate.
Logo (July 8, 2005-August 9, 2009)
Visuals: On a white background, a royal blue square zooms in. Then a white rectangle zooms in with "MARK" in Impact and cut out from it, with the same text but in black. Both of them zoom in and out a bit.
Technique: Decent animation.
Audio: Some whooshes, then a weird sound, and finally a male announcer saying the company name.
Availability: Seen on Stankervision on MTV2, Parco P.I. on Court TV and Z Rock on IFC.
Legacy: This logo resembles the Modern Cartoons logo.
